Styles of Kitchen Faucets

The sink tap usage to be just functional; the objective was to deliver water to sinks for cooking or cleansing. Nobody really thought about what it appeared like or if it matched the design in the space. Those days more than. Cooking area components are currently offered in a series of coatings as well as styles to match every house.

A few of the readily available coatings consist of:

+ Brass (natural is extra preferred than sleek).
+ Weather-beaten brass.
+ Nickel.
+ Bronze.
+ Vintage copper.
+ Combed nickel.
+ Stainless-steel.
+ Porcelain.
+ Chrome.
+ Black.

The combed and also weathered appearance is extra preferred than the glossy, sleek coatings. The brightened chrome tap is usually utilized in contemporary style cooking areas currently. Clarify Victorian styles are offered for more formal looking kitchens. Their use as a design attribute has actually led to fixtures being one of one of the most prominent upgrades for people acquiring a brand-new house.

If your home has monotonous components that seem out of date or don't match your home, changing them is simple and inexpensive. Just make it part of a tiny house improvement and also design project. The rate for substitutes varies as well as the finish contributes in the cost. Chrome is the least expensive and also most resilient material made use of. Other products can be a fair bit more pricey and call for extra treatment. Visit your local plumbing or house improvement shop to see the different designs offered. Setup Treatments.

The new taps are simpler to mount than older designs. Many manufacturers consist of all links as well as fittings required to install the device on your own. Full setup guidelines are included with the tap. Search for full sets that feature the versatile tubes needed to connect to your water. If these aren't included, you will certainly need to acquire them separately. Do not be alarmed if you discover fragments in the water when you finish setup. This is simply particles caught in the component from manufacturing as well as installation. They will wash clear if you let the water run for a couple of minutes.

Kitchen Area Taps: Fixing and Maintenance.

Fixing and also maintenance is simpler than in the past and can be done by an useful home owner. Rubber rings can be easily replaced in the house when required. Prior to working on the sink, turn off the water and also cover the drains. Appropriately cleansing and also maintaining your faucet will certainly expand the life and keep it in good working order.

Inspect the maker's instructions for cleansing the coating. Most can be cleaned up with light soap and water or window cleaner. Do not use severe cleansing items, which can harm the coating. Polish matte finishes with a furniture brightens. Examine the label to make sure the item you use is safe for the material of your components.

When to Replace Your Kitchen Faucet?


We can agree that the kitchen faucet is the most overused appliance in any home. The faucet comes in handy to make sure that your dishes do not go into the dishwasher with lots of grime. It’s where you wash your fresh vegetables and fruits. The faucet is also centrally placed and acts as the central hand-washing base.



For these reasons, you should ensure that the faucet is functioning properly. When the faucet malfunctions, a lot of kitchen activities will be thrown off balance. Your kitchen and home generally depend on the faucet’s functionality for smooth operations.



However, just like most appliances, it is not designed to last forever, and a kitchen faucet repair will be inevitable. After serving you and your family for a reasonable period, it will begin to wear out, resulting in the need for a repair or replacement.


Signs That the Kitchen Faucet Requires Repair


How do you know that your kitchen faucet requires some repair or replacement? Below are some of the signs you should look out for.


Visible Mineral Deposits


After a long period of use, you will notice mineral deposits building up in the faucet, reducing its performance. These mineral deposits often resemble a build-up of old toothpaste, and they will build up both inside the spigot and around the base.



The mineral deposits are unavoidable due to the hard water we use in our homes. It is, therefore, not uncommon to find your faucet clogged with mineral deposits. However, the presence of the deposits affects the normal functioning of the faucet as well as its appearance. The flanges, gaskets, and filters might clog, blocking the passage of water.



Using a water softener solution could help reduce mineral deposit build-up in the kitchen faucet. This is, however, not a permanent solution, and the deposits will finally show, which is a sign that it is time for a kitchen faucet repair.


Extremely Old Faucet


The lifespan of your kitchen faucet will depend on several factors, among them being its model and make. However, it can be very challenging to find out the type of faucet you have in your kitchen, but there are many ways to find out.



For instance, you can look at the model number, which is often printed on the underside or back of the spout. The manufacturer’s information about the faucet will help you assess the model, and subsequently, its lifespan. If, by all means, you cannot figure out the lifespan of your kitchen faucet, you can replace it after 10-15 years.


Rust


Does your kitchen faucet crack or stick when you move it? Does the water take some time to run through it? If so, these are signs that your faucet is internally corroded or rusted. Once the faucet begins to break down from rust, there is nothing much you can do to repair it. You will have to replace it with a new one.



Rust will have built up internally long before it’s even externally visible. You will start noticing rust around the spigot and the base. If corrosion and rust are not addressed, your kitchen faucet becomes less effective and more leak-prone over time.


Consistent Leaking, Even After Repairs


Minor kitchen faucet malfunctions can usually be repaired with a simple cartridge replacement. However, that alone might not be enough in some cases. If the faucet does not stop leaking after repairing it a couple of times, then it is time to replace it.



You should not waste your resources replacing a faucet that does not respond to repair. A leaking kitchen faucet is not only annoying, but constant leakage might result in mold growth. Replacing a malfunctioning faucet saves you money compared to attempting multiple repairs that yield no results.
